#8f9924 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f9924 is composed of 56.1% red, 60%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 65.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 37.1%. #8f9924 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#1f3300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#8f9924 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8f9924 has RGB values of R:143, G:153,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9410852.

Hex triplet 8f9924 #8f9924
RGB Decimal 143, 153, 36 rgb(143,153,36)
RGB Percent 56.1, 60, 14.1 rgb(56.1%,60%,14.1%)
CMYK 7, 0, 76, 40
HSL 65.1°, 61.9, 37.1 hsl(65.1,61.9%,37.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 65.1°, 76.5, 60
Web Safe 999933 #999933
CIE-LAB 60.56, -18.254, 55.873
XYZ 23.037, 28.75, 6.005
xyY 0.399, 0.497, 28.75
CIE-LCH 60.56, 58.779, 108.093
CIE-LUV 60.56, -2.15, 62.599
Hunter-Lab 53.619, -17.14, 30.893
Binary 10001111, 10011001, 00100100

Shades and Tints of #8f9924

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a02 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.
